    At 89, Donald Tenbrunsel is somewhat of a marvel. He surfs the web easily, cheerfully speaks on a wide scope of auspicious points, volunteers and peruses frequently. 

    Known as a "SuperAger," Tenbrunsel was a piece of an examination that helped scientists find what variables may separate these super-sharp seniors from their companions. 
    The mystery? Cerebrum examines indicated they encounter mind maturing twice as gradually as normal people their age. 

    For the examination, Rogalski and her associates estimated cerebrum maturing by analyzing the thickness of every individual's cortex - the external layer of the collapsed dim issue in the mind. 

    The cortex is the place awareness lies, and where the greater part of the neurons that fire musings and developments are found. It is a basic piece of the cerebrum for larger amount considering, memory, arranging and critical thinking, Rogalski said. 

    Rogalski noticed that past research has demonstrated that the cortexes of SuperAgers look less worn than their normal 80-year-old associates, and about the same as individuals in their 50s or 60s. 

    In any case, an inquiry remained - were the SuperAgers conceived with brains that have more volume, and hence could better withstand the travails of maturing? Or on the other hand are their brains an indistinguishable size from everybody else's, and essentially maturing less quickly? 

    To answer that inquiry, the analysts followed changes in cortex thickness for eighteen months in 24 SuperAgers and 12 normal elderly individuals. 
    The two gatherings lost a lot of cerebrum volume to maturing, yet normal elderly individuals encountered a misfortune more than twice that of the SuperAgers - more than 2.2 percent versus 1.1 percent. 

    "Some portion of the motivation behind why they may have distinctive cerebrum volumes is on the grounds that throughout the decades they've been losing their mind volume at an alternate rate," Rogalski said. 

    The discoveries were distributed April four within the Journal of the Yankee Medical Association. 

    Dr. Ezriel Kornel, a brain doctor with Kurt Weill Cornell Medical faculty in big apple town, aforesaid that at any rate, some portion of the neural structure advantage of SuperAgers is hereditary, with some individuals primarily proficient throughout parturition

    Yet, there are probably going to be natural impacts that additionally add to more beneficial cerebrum maturing, especially in the womb and in early youth, Kornel included. For instance, examine has demonstrated that youngsters brought up in destitution have a tendency to have little brains. 

    "There are such huge numbers of components included," Kornel said. "It may be the case that even outer stressors in adolescence can impact how the cerebrum creates." 
    Rogalski said that future research will center around hereditary variables that impact mind maturing, which ideally will give analysts hostile to maturing "focuses on" that could be controlled with meds or different treatments. 

    While there's as of now no demonstrated technique to protect cortex volume, investigate has indicated the particular way of life changes that seniors can perform to help keep themselves sharp as they age, Kornel and Wright said. These include:

     
    - Regular physical exercise, including quality preparing. 
    - A solid and adjusted eating regimen. 
    - Brain exercises that include testing riddles or errands. 
    - A dynamic social life. 


    "Everybody comprehends they will kick the bucket, however, individuals would prefer not to feel they're losing their capacity to think and be their identity," Kornel said. "This is the following huge outskirts in science, to make sense of how we can counteract general crumbling of the cerebrum." 

    "This recommends the SuperAgers are in an alternate direction of maturing," said senior analyst Emily Rogalski. She is executive of neuroimaging for Northwestern University's Cognitive Neurology and Alzheimer's Disease Center. "They're losing their cerebrum volume at a much slower rate than normal agers."
